Abstract

The use of social media continues to increase in modern cultures in recent years. This new context leads to creating a virtual self, which somewhat differs from the real self. Further, social relations are set and maintained predominantly in this new context. There is no doubt that social media does not only affect individuals' social relations but also their cognitive skills by pulling them into new situations that they are unfamiliar with. In this new context, content coded in social media can be remembered in real life, and content coded in real life can be remembered in social media. This new context, where mostly real-life stories are shared, is likely to strongly affect the autobiographical memory processes of individuals. Past research suggests that social media affects autobiographical memory processes both directly (phenomenological characteristics, functions) and indirectly through cognitive processes (eg, attention, working memory, transitive memory). Studies about its indirect effects indicate that people with limited attention and working memory capacity have difficulty processing the high number of stimuli offered by social media. Given that the long-term memory capacity is not limited, it is plausible to expect that some of the contents are encoded into the memory; however, problems may occur in the storage and retrieval processes. Studies about the direct effect of social media show that the phenomenological characteristics (number of details, accuracy, emotional content) and functions (self, social, directing, therapeutic) of events experienced or shared on social media differ from real-life events. This theoretical review discusses the effects of social media use on cognitive processes related to memory processes and more specifically on the phenomenological and functional characteristics of autobiographical memory. To recognize and prevent potential psychological issues that may emerge in relation to this new setting, it appears essential to comprehend how social media affects autobiographical memory, which is essential for self-perception.
